StiflerSBR MVP
- 11-11-09
- 3511
#1135The utah win was the first game of the new starting streak. If they W the next 2 games on the road ATS they will qualify for the next series play.
W
W
W - 3 game winning streak
W - start series with A Bet (new potential winning streak starts aswell)
W
W - 3 game winning streak, next series would start on their next gameComment -

#1138The utah win was the first game of the new starting streak. If they W the next 2 games on the road ATS they will qualify for the next series play.
W
W
W - 3 game winning streak
W - start series with A Bet (new potential winning streak starts aswell)
W
W - 3 game winning streak, next series would start on their next game
I thought you always just look back 3 games - in fact I thought it made a lot of sense to me since you would take advantage of long ATS streaks.
Example:
Instead of:
W
W
W - 3 game winning streak
W - start series with A Bet (new potential winning streak starts aswell) - 1 UNIT WON HERE
W
W - 3 game winning streak, next series would start on their next game
W - start series with A Bet - 1 UNIT WON HERE
By continuing the A bets you get:
W
W
W - 3 game winning streak
W - start series with A Bet (new potential winning streak starts aswell) - 1 UNIT WON HERE
W - 1 UNIT WON HERE
W - 1 UNIT WON HERE
W - 1 UNIT WON HERE
Have you backtested it betting the streak like this?
DGComment -
